Guelph Houses - On the trail of nobility


Picture: Schloss Marienburg They are the oldest traceable dynasty in Europe: the Guelphs. In the holiday destination of Niedersachsen the descendants of Henry the Lion left behind a lot of trails and there are many venues, at which the exciting and chequered past of the high nobility can be remembered. The family history of the Guelphs of more than a thousand years puts all other dynasties in the shade.


Picture: Braunschweig - Burgplatz in front of the castle with a lion The close connection to the English royal family ensured that the princes of Hannover and the dukes of Braunschweig had a considerable influence on European dynamics. Whether Marienburg Castle or the Royal Gardens of Herrenhausen – the Guelphs have left behind many extraordinary culture gems, which will impress you on a thrilling royal journey of discovery!
